From ed8f2a85b767b01f37b79294d2223483d4eeae91 Mon Sep 17 00:00:00 2001 From: Pascal Vizeli Date: Thu, 4 Feb 2021 16:06:12 +0100 Subject: [PATCH] Fix memory stats calc (#2518) --- supervisor/docker/stats.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/supervisor/docker/stats.py b/supervisor/docker/stats.py index cf8fd5734..b5853f177 100644 --- a/supervisor/docker/stats.py +++ b/supervisor/docker/stats.py @@ -14,7 +14,9 @@ class DockerStats: self._blk_write = 0 try: - self._memory_usage = stats["memory_stats"]["usage"] + self._memory_usage = ( + stats["memory_stats"]["usage"] - stats["memory_stats"]["stats"]["cache"] + ) self._memory_limit = stats["memory_stats"]["limit"] except KeyError: self._memory_usage = 0